And it's not just a nice idea, the data backs it up:

  • 70% of employers say creative thinking is the most in-demand skill in 2024, outpacing technical expertise and even leadership experience. (Forbes, 2024)

  • In a recent global study done by Gallup, only 1 in 4 employees strongly agree that they can take risks at work - and those who can are 2.5x more likely to be engaged.

  • The IBM Global CEO Study ranks creativity as the #1 leadership competency needed to navigate complexity.
